关于一个静不定杆系变形协调条件的讨论  

Discussion on the Deformation Coordination Condition of a Statically Indeterminate Bar System

摘  要:研究了一个静不定杆系的内力求解问题。由于静不定杆系内力的矩阵与位移的矩阵是互为转置矩阵,所以可方便求得静不定杆系的变形协调条件。针对该静不定杆系的内力求解问题,指出有关文献给出的该静不定杆系的变形协调条件是错误的。The equation solving problem of internal force of a statically indeterminate rod system is studied.Because the matrix of internal force and the matrix of displacement of statically indeterminate bar system are transposed each other,the deformation compatibility condition of statically indeterminate bar system can be easily obtained.Aiming at solving the internal force of statically indeterminate bar system,it is pointed out that the deformation compatibility condition of statically indeterminate bar system given in relevant literatures is wrong.
